Realme Q5 series launching tomorrow: how to watch the launch event

Realme will be announcing the Realme Q5 series of smartphones tomorrow at 2 PM (local time) on April 20 in China. The lineup includes three smartphones such as the Realme Q5 Pro, Realme Q5, and Realme Q5i. However, the Q5i was announced earlier this week in the home market. The TENAA listings of the Q5 and Q5 Pro phones that have appeared in recent days have revealed all their major specifications.

Realme Q5 Pro specifications (rumored)

Realme Q5 Pro
Realme Q5 Pro image by Evan Blass

The Realme Q5 Pro (RMX3372 model number) has a 6.62-inch FHD+ AMOLED display with a 120Hz refresh rate and an under-display fingerprint scanner. It has a 16-megapixel front camera, and a 64-megapixel + 8-megapixel (ultrawide) + 2-megapixel (macro) triple camera unit. The Snapdragon 870 powered device will offer up to 12 GB of RAM and up to 512 GB of built-in storage.

It will come with a 5,000mAh battery that supports 80W fast charging. A recent leak claimed that the company may also introduce the Realme Q5 Pro Vans Special Edition with a unique design.

Realme Q5 specifications (rumored)

Realme Q5
Realme Q5 images at TENAA

The Realme Q5 (RMX3478 model number) will come with a 6.58-inch LCD FHD+ panel, a 16-megapixel front camera, and a 50-megapixel + 2-megapixel + 2-megapixel triple rear cameras. The Snapdragon 695 powered device will offer up to 12 GB of RAM, up to 256 GB of storage, a side-facing fingerprint scanner, and a 5,000mAh battery with 65W fast charging.

Realme Q5i specifications

Realme Q5i
Realme Q5i

The Realme Q5i has a 6.58-inch LCD FHD+ 90Hz screen, an 8-megapixel selfie snapper, and a 13-megapixel + 2-megapixel + 2-megapixel triple camera unit. The Dimensity 810 powered smartphone may offer up to 6 GB of RAM, 128 GB of internal storage, a side-mounted fingerprint sensor, and a 5,000mAh battery that supports 33W rapid charging. All three phones are preinstalled with Android 12 OS and Realme UI 3.0. It carries a starting price of 1,199 Yuan (~$187).

Sony IMX989 sensor details leaked, rumored to debut with the Xiaomi 12 Ultra

Last month, news emerged that the upcoming Vivo X80 Pro will feature Sony’s IMX8 series sensor for its primary camera. The sensor is rumored to be the IMX866. Now, news has emerged that Sony has another camera sensor under wraps, which may be the IMX989.

Sony IMX989

According to Weibo tipster DigitalChatStation, Sony has an upcoming 50-megapixel sensor in the IMX9 series, which could be called the IMX989. The tipster adds that this sensor is close to 1inch (hypothetical) in size.

The tipster has previously stated that the upcoming IMX9 series sensor will first debut in the upcoming Xiaomi 12 Ultra smartphone. So we can expect the 12 Ultra to come equipped with massive photographic capabilities housing the near 1-inch IMX989 sensor.

Xiaomi 12 Ultra specs (rumored)

Xiaomi 12 Ultra concept render by LetsGoDigital
Xiaomi 12 Ultra concept render by LetsGoDigital

So far, rumors about the device have stated that it will come with a 6.73″ 2K 120Hz E5 AMOLED Display display supporting LTPO 2.0 technology.

The camera setup at the rear will comprise a 50MP primary sensor with OIS support, 48MP ultrawide again with OIS support, and finally a 48MP telephoto lens with 120x zoom support.

Under the hood, there will be the TSMC-made Snapdragon 8 Gen 1 Plus chip, fueled by a 4900mAh battery with 120W fast charging support. The phone will also pack stereo speakers and feature an IP68 water resistance rating. It will boot to Android 12 out of the box.

Although there is no confirmation regarding the device as of yet, it is rumored to launch around the end of Q2 2022.

POCO Buds Pro Genshin Impact Edition spotted on Bluetooth SIG certification

POCO is gearing up to launch a new smartphone later this month. It is the F4 GT, which is set to be unveiled on April 26. However, it seems that will launch alongside a hearable, which might be the POCO Buds Pro Genshin Impact Edition.

POCO
Redmi AirDots 3 Pro Genshin Impact Edition

The special edition of the truly wireless earbuds was recently spotted receiving the Bluetooth SIG certification. In other words, its launch might be imminent and with the F4 GT announcement being just around the corner, it won’t be a surprise if the Chinese smartphone maker released both products together. The earbuds were spotted on the Bluetooth SIG website carrying the model number TWSEJ01ZM, which also hints that it is a rebranded version of the same limited edition model of another earbud from Redmi.

For those unaware, Xiaomi had launched the Redmi AirDots 3 Pro back in May 2021. Furthermore, it even released a Redmi AirDots 3 Pro Genshin Impact Edition earlier this year. Apart from special additions in its design, the limited edition model was identical to the AirDots 3 Pro. So, we can already make some educated guesses regarding the POCO Buds Pro Genshin Impact Edition’s specifications. It will likely house a 9mm audio driver, support active noise cancellation up to 35 decibels, and even offer a transparency mode as well.

Redmi Airdots 3 Pro Genshin Impact

Other features include Bluetooth 5.2, a dedicated gaming mode with 69ms latency, a triple microphone setup for the environmental noise cancellation feature, IPX4 water resistance rating, gesture controls, and more. The new special edition wireless earphone might also pack the same 35mAh battery pack for each earbud that offers 6 hours of audio playback and another 28 hours of total playback from its 470mAh battery pack on the charging case. Keep in mind that it is still too early to tell, and this is just speculation at the moment, so take this report with a pinch of salt.

HP may be working on 17 inch laptop with foldable OLED display: Report

HP is apparently planning on launching a new 17 inch foldable laptop. The latest rumor is that the company working on a laptop with a flexible OLED display and is sourcing a cover for this screen from a South Korean supplier.

HP

According to TheElec report, the known PC maker is supplying the thin ad flexible polyimide (PI) film that will cover the 17 inch flexible OLED panel for its foldable laptops from South Korean conglomerate, SK IE Technology (SKIET). For those unaware, foldable panels that brands employ usually consist of either UTG (Ultra Thin Glass) or the PI film. The former is prominent in Samsung Galaxy Z series devices. But it seems that Hewlett-Packard’s foldable laptop will favor the latter.

As per recent rumors, the foldable laptop will sport a 17 inch panel that has a 4K resolution. Furthermore, in its compact form, it will measure just 11 inches and can unfold to its full size of 17 inch. So, it’s likely that the display technology is from LG, which showcased larger sized bendable OLEDs back at the CES 2022 event. In other words, there’s a chance that it might also come with a stylus and touchscreen support.

TheElec found that SKIET and LG will be shipping around 10,000 flexible OLED displays and protective films to HP. The limited quantity is likely due to the niche market that the foldable device targets. Meaning, it is probably going to be quite expensive as well. Okinawa dealership in flames after Praise Pro e-scooters catch fire, company issues recall

The track record of EVs (Electric Vehicles) in India isn’t looking too good with all the recent fire related accidents. And now, another major incident has just surfaced as an entire Okinawa Autotech dealership got burnt down, which is believed to be caused by an EV inside the store.

Okinawa

According to a 91Mobiles report, this incident has caused the company to issue a recall for its Praise Pro electric scooters. Apparently, the reason for the recall is under a fault check up and redressal service. The brand had issued a recall for 3,215 units of its EVs on 16th April 2022. The units were the Okinawa Praise Pro e-scooters, which are apparently facing an issue with their battery pack, which caused the fire related accident.

For those unaware, three of the company’s e-scooters caught fire back in October 2021. This ended up causing injuries to two people. On the other hand, the fire accident in the dealership was even more intense, but it remains to be seen how extensive the damage really was. But looking at videos shared on social media, we can assume that it is unlikely that anything was left uncharred on the inside.

The accident might have been caused by just one faulty battery but its flames ended up engulfing the entire dealership. As of right now, it was reported that there were no casualties and the fire was put out eventually. This marks another case of EVs and a fire accident in India. There could be many reasons for this accident like the poor design or thermal management system for the battery. But we have no way of knowing for sure at the moment.

Huawei Smart Door Lock Pro now up for pre-order in China; price starts at 2,499 yuan ($392)

Huawei has been focusing on other products to expand its portfolio as it cannot generate much revenue through smartphones given that the brand is facing some heavy sanctions from the United States.

In line with that, the Chinese company has been focusing on a wide range of products and one of them is Smart Home devices. Last month, Huawei Smart Door Lock and Smart Door Lock Pro were announced in China.

Huawei Smart Door Lock Pro Pre-Order in China

Today, the company has started taking pre-orders for both devices. The Huawei Smart Door Lock is priced at 2,499 yuan (~$392) while the Pro model costs 3,699 yuan (~$580). The products can now be pre-ordered through Huawei Mall and JD.com and will go on sale from 28th April in the Chinese market.

Both these new smart door locks come powered by Huawei’s self-developed HarmonyOS, making it the world’s first smart lock to be using HarmonyOS. Thus, it is also a part of the HarmonyOS ecosystem and can be connected to other smart devices within the home.

The Smart Door Lock Pro is capable of 3D facial recognition and its AI architecture ensures self-learning that improves facial recognition over time. It is claimed to unlock the door within a couple of seconds of assessing the person at the door.

Huawei Smart Door Lock Pro

The company says that there’s a probability of 1 in a million that it will unlock the door for someone who ought not to gain access. It features a P50 Pro camera that can identify objects within a 150-degree viewing angle.

The device works for persons between 3.4 ft and 6.6 ft and can also work in both bright and dark light situations. The Huawei Smart Door Lock Pro has a 3.97-inch display that enables the owner to view persons at the door.

Huawei Smart Door Lock Pro also has several unlocking options including automatic, fingerprint, smartphone or smartwatch, password, NFC card, and a physical key. It is powered by an 8,800mAh battery that offers up to 6 months of daily usage.

Apple iPhone 14 design & camera bump size showcased in leaked molds

Over the last couple of weeks, we have reported on various leaks and rumors regarding the 2022 Apple iPhone lineup. And now, another new leak has just surfaced, which showcases the design of the entire iPhone 14 series.

Apple

According to a MacRumors report, the latest leak comes from images of iPhone 14 series molds that showcase the design and the camera bump size of the four models. The report further added that these molds were found on Weibo (a Chinese microblogging website). So, they are likely to be molds used for third party iPhone protective covers rather than the ones used for the actual smartphones’ production.

Looking at these molds, the most noticeable aspect is undoubtedly the lack of an iPhone mini model. Apart from that, we can also observe changes in the iPhones’ sizes in 2022. This year, the Cupertino based giant is apparently getting rid of the 5.4 inch iPhone model, which did not perform too well in the smartphone market. So due to the poor sales, the company is now leaning toward larger iPhone sizes. Thus, the four molds we see include the 6.1 inch iPhone 14, 6.1 inch iPhone 14 Pro, 6.7 inch iPhone 14 Max, and the 6.7 inch iPhone 14 Pro Max.

Apple iPhone 14 Pro

Another notable change in design with the 2022 iPhones is the camera bump. Apparently, the camera bump sizes for the entire lineup will be taller than the previous generation, the iPhone 13 lineup. But for the most part, the iPhone 14 series will feature a similar design, with flat edges and rounded corners. On the other hand, the front is expected to finally replace the large notch in favor of a circular punch hole cutout.

Xiaomi launches the MIJIA dual-brush wireless mopping machine

Robot vacuum cleaners that perform the dual functions of sweeping and mopping are quite common these days but if you have used one, you’ll agree that they don’t provide the same dexterity that a handheld mop will give you. Xiaomi seems to have provided a solution to that by launching a dedicated mechanical mop. The device is dubbed MIJIA dual-brush wireless mopping machine.MIJIA dual-brush wireless mopping machine

As the name implies, the MIJIA dual-brush wireless mopping machine adopts an innovative dual-brush design and supports real-time spray cleaning. The front brush washes the dirt in the front while the brush at the back wipes the stains in the back thus improving the cleaning efficiency of the user. The self-driving traction force of the motor enables smooth pushing and pulling for free cleaning.MIJIA dual-brush wireless mopping machine

At the same time, this product also adopts a frameless design. The front roller brush can deform to take the shape of wall edges in other to effectively clean the edges where the floor meets the wall.

In addition, the MIJIA mopping machine can spray clean the roller brush with clean water in real-time to keep it clean after use. Furthermore, after the cleaning is over, all the user needs to do is to put the brush back on the base and turn on the auxiliary cleaning with one button to simulate manual hand washing, reducing the frequency of cleaning the roller brush and making it more convenient to take care of.MIJIA dual-brush wireless mopping machine

In addition, when cleaning low places such as the bottom of the sofa and underneath the bed, the MIJIA double-brush wireless mopping machine can be adjusted to assume a lay-flat state, with a lay-flat thickness of 13cm. It also supports 90° up and down rotation in this state. The machine can also be left upright anytime, anywhere. It also automatically stops when the water is empty or the degree of dirt is high and emits a buzzer sound to remind you to clean up in time.

In terms of the core configuration, the battery of the MIJIA Dual-brush wireless mopping machine can last for up to 35 minutes. It also packs a built-in 420mL water purification tank and a 200mL sewage tank.MIJIA dual-brush wireless mopping machine

The MIJIA mopping machine carries a crowdfunding price of 899 yuan (~$141) and will be up for backing at 10:00 am on April 20. The mop will retail for 999 yuan (~$156).

Google’s upcoming Pixel 6a smartphone may not come with Motion Mode feature

Google is gearing up to launch a new budget smartphone — Google Pixel 6a. As the name indicates, the device will be a watered-down model of the Pixel 6 and the successor to the Pixel 5a smartphone.

Ahead of the official announcement of the Google Pixel 6a smartphone, there have been a few leaks, revealing some key details about the upcoming device. Now, a new report has shed more light on the camera features.

Google Pixel 6a CAD renders by 91mobiles/Steve Hemmerstoffer
Google Pixel 6a CAD renders by 91mobiles/Steve Hemmerstoffer

The latest report claims that the upcoming Pixel 6a will lack the Motion Mode for the camera department. The feature adds blurs to the moving part and action pan, which applies a blur effect to the background.

A report coming from XDA-Developers indicates that the code for displaying Pixel Tips about Motion Mode has excluded a device codenamed “bluejay,” which is said to be the identifier for the Pixel 6a.

The reason behind excluding this feature from the device could be because of the lack of a 50-megapixel camera sensor on the Pixel 6a as it needs a higher-resolution sensor to work. The phone is expected to have a 12.2-megapixel primary sensor which it has been using for the past few years on its Pixel A-series smartphones.

Based on the information leaked so far, it appears that the Google Pixel 6a will continue to have the same design as its predecessor, featuring a 6.2-inch display. Internally, the device will come powered by the Google Tensor SoC, which is powering the Pixel 6 series phones.

Samsung to increase usage of Exynos chips in mid-range and low-end phones

Samsung is one of the handful of smartphone manufacturers globally that makes its own chipsets. However, unlike Apple, the South Korean giant also uses chips from Qualcomm and MediaTek for its smartphones.

But it appears that the company is going to make a change in its strategy for the usage of processors in its smartphones as it aims to increase the usage of its own Exynos chips.

Samsung Exynos

As per the new report, Samsung Electronics is now shifting its focus toward the Galaxy A-series and Galaxy M-series smartphones. With that, the company hints at shifting its focus from developed countries to emerging markets.

The report adds that as a part of that strategy, the South Korean giant is also set to increase the usage of its own chipsets in mid-range and low-end smartphones.

In line with that, the company has used the Samsung Exynos 850 processor in the newly launched Galaxy A13 4G smartphone in the North American market. The Samsung Galaxy A13 5G has already been launched, powered by the MediaTek Dimensity 700 processor.

As the name clearly indicates, the Galaxy A13 is the successor of the Galaxy A12, which shipped 51.8 million units in the year 2021. With that, it became the world’s best-selling smartphone model and the first smartphone ever to sell more than 50 million units.

The Samsung Galaxy A13 was powered by the MediaTek Helio P35 processor and thus it played a major role in the rise of MediaTek’s market share. With Galaxy A13 4G powered by Samsung Exynos 850 chip and 5G model of the smartphone powered by MediaTek chip, the company is eyeing to increase the market share of Exynos chips.
